Seven die in France from causes related to heatwave

Follow Us :
Text Size:

PARIS, May 26 (Reuters) – Seven people have died in France in circumstances related directly or indirectly to the current heatwave, French Junior Energy Minister Maud Bregeon said on Tuesday.

• Five of the seven fatalities were people drowning in lakes, rivers or beaches, Bregeon said.

• The government has ordered local authorities to take measures to protect people during sport events, she said.

• France has been experiencing higher-than-average temperatures since Saturday.

• Most of Brittany has been put under an orange level warning by weather agency Meteo France, which expects temperatures to reach up to 36 degrees Celsius on Tuesday afternoon.

• The heatwave is expected to continue on Wednesday and Thursday, Meteo France said on its website.
